黑狐家游戏

服务器环境配置指南,服务器环境配置心得体会

欧气 1 0

在当今数字化时代,服务器的性能和稳定性对企业和个人的业务运营至关重要,本指南将详细介绍如何高效地配置服务器环境,确保其能够满足各种应用需求。

选择合适的硬件平台

  1. 处理器(CPU):根据负载类型选择适当的主频和核心数,对于需要大量并行处理的任务,多核处理器更为合适;而对于单线程性能要求高的任务,高主频的单核处理器可能更优。

  2. 内存(RAM):足够的内存容量是保证系统流畅运行的关键,通常情况下,建议至少配备8GB或16GB以上的DDR4 RAM,以应对日常工作和开发测试的需求。

  3. 存储设备:固态硬盘(SSD)因其读写速度快而成为首选,尤其是在数据库访问频繁的场景下,还可以考虑使用NVMe协议来进一步提升数据传输速度。

    服务器环境配置指南,服务器环境配置心得体会

    图片来源于网络,如有侵权联系删除

  4. 网络接口卡(NIC):高性能的网络连接对于远程办公和企业级应用至关重要,选购时需注意带宽和延迟等参数。

操作系统安装与优化

  1. 选择操作系统:常见的有Windows Server、Linux发行版(如Ubuntu Server、CentOS等),根据自己的需求和预算做出合理的选择。

  2. 安全设置:安装必要的防病毒软件和安全补丁,定期更新系统以确保安全性。

  3. 资源管理:通过调整进程优先级、关闭不必要的服务和端口等方式释放更多系统资源。

网络配置与管理

  1. IP地址分配:为服务器分配静态IP地址以便于管理和监控。

  2. DNS解析:配置域名解析记录,使得外部可以通过域名访问内部的服务器。

  3. 防火墙规则:根据实际需求设置防火墙策略,既要保障网络安全又要避免影响正常服务。

应用程序部署与服务管理

  1. Web服务器:如Apache、Nginx等,用于托管网站和应用。

  2. 数据库管理系统:MySQL、PostgreSQL等,用于存储和管理数据。

  3. 中间件:如Tomcat、Jboss等Java EE容器,支持企业级应用的开发和部署。

备份与恢复策略

  1. 定期备份:制定完整的备份计划,包括文件备份、数据库备份以及整个系统的镜像备份。

    服务器环境配置指南,服务器环境配置心得体会

    图片来源于网络,如有侵权联系删除

  2. 异地容灾:建立冗余数据中心或云服务提供商进行数据的异地存放,以防万一本地服务器出现问题导致的数据丢失。

监控与日志管理

  1. 实时监控系统:利用Zabbix、Prometheus等工具实时监测服务器的各项指标,及时发现潜在问题。

  2. 日志分析:收集和分析服务器日志,帮助定位故障原因并进行预防性维护。

持续集成/交付(CI/CD)

  1. 自动化构建:采用Jenkins、GitLab CI等工具实现代码自动编译和测试。

  2. 部署流程:设计高效的发布管道,从代码提交到生产环境的上线无缝衔接。

运维团队建设与管理

  1. 人员培训:培养专业的IT技术人员,掌握最新的技术和最佳实践。

  2. 文档化操作:创建详细的操作手册和技术文档,方便团队成员快速上手和新员工入职培训。

法律法规遵守与合规性审查

  1. 隐私保护:确保所有数据处理符合GDPR、CCPA等相关法规的要求。

  2. 行业规范:遵循特定行业的标准和规定,比如医疗保健领域的HIPAA标准。

通过以上步骤,我们可以构建出一个稳定、高效且安全的虚拟专用服务器环境,这不仅有助于提升工作效率和质量,还能降低运营成本和维护风险,随着技术的不断进步和发展,我们需要持续学习和适应新的技术趋势,以满足日益增长的业务需求。

标签: #服务器环境配置

黑狐家游戏
  • 评论列表

留言评论